From automated simulations to real-time hardware control, the Matlab AI code generator is transforming how engineers develop and deploy algorithms. Explore why this technology is at the core of modern engineering workflows and which tools stand out in 2025.
Why the Matlab AI Code Generator Is a Game-Changer for Engineers
Over the past few years, engineering teams have witnessed a dramatic shift in how algorithms are written, tested, and deployed. The rise of the Matlab AI code generator is one of the leading catalysts behind this transformation. Rather than manually writing thousands of lines of code, professionals can now rely on AI to automate much of the process — reducing time-to-market, increasing reliability, and freeing up resources for creative design.
Benefits of AI-Driven Matlab Code Generation:
?? Accelerates prototyping and simulation
?? Automatically translates models into deployable code
?? Enhances code consistency and reduces human error
?? Supports embedded system and FPGA deployment
How Matlab AI Code Generation Works
At its core, Matlab AI code generation utilizes advanced AI models trained on vast engineering datasets to understand patterns in algorithm design. Whether you're working with control systems, signal processing, robotics, or IoT applications, these AI models can generate optimized code in C, C++, HDL, or CUDA formats that are ready to compile and deploy.
The AI Matlab code generator leverages built-in toolboxes such as Simulink, MATLAB Coder, and Embedded Coder to streamline this process. Engineers simply define their models or logic visually or through scripts, and the AI handles the rest.
Best AI for Matlab Code: Top Tools in 2025
?? MATLAB Coder
A native tool from MathWorks that converts MATLAB functions into C/C++ code. Highly useful for embedded system development and real-time applications.
?? Deep Learning HDL Toolbox
Generates synthesizable HDL code from deep learning networks for deployment on FPGAs and SoCs. It’s one of the best AI for Matlab code when targeting hardware.
?? Embedded Coder
Extends MATLAB Coder and Simulink Coder capabilities, providing customizable code generation with hardware-in-the-loop (HIL) testing support.
Real-World Engineering Applications Using Matlab AI Code Generator
Today’s engineering workflows demand rapid development cycles and scalable code generation. The AI Matlab code generator is widely used across industries including automotive, aerospace, and robotics. Below are some real-life examples:
?? Automotive Control Systems: Generating real-time code for engine control units and safety diagnostics using Simulink models.
??? Aerospace Flight Simulators: Designing and deploying flight control algorithms that adapt to changing environmental conditions.
?? Autonomous Robots: Creating AI-powered motion planning code optimized for microcontrollers and embedded platforms.
Key Features That Make Matlab AI Code Generation Unique
What sets the Matlab AI code generator apart from other development tools is its seamless integration with MathWorks' ecosystem and its support for hardware-targeted deployment. Here are the standout features:
?? AI-driven optimization of generated code for performance and size
?? Compatibility with more than 200 embedded hardware platforms
?? Automatic documentation generation
?? Real-time simulation and testing capabilities
?? Support for ANSI/ISO-compliant C and C++ code
How Matlab AI Code Generators Improve Productivity
Traditional coding can be time-consuming and prone to errors, especially when developing complex engineering systems. The Matlab AI code generator significantly boosts productivity by enabling:
Rapid Prototyping: Engineers can move from idea to simulation within hours instead of weeks.
Error Reduction: AI reduces the risk of bugs in mission-critical applications.
Consistency: Code generated by AI follows uniform standards, which is essential for team collaboration.
Getting Started with AI Matlab Code Generation
To take advantage of Matlab AI code generation, you’ll need a licensed version of MATLAB along with toolboxes like Simulink, MATLAB Coder, and Embedded Coder. MathWorks also provides extensive documentation, tutorials, and webinars to help you get started quickly.
Additionally, many third-party platforms like GitHub and MATLAB Central offer code repositories, examples, and user-contributed models that make learning even easier.
Challenges and Limitations to Consider
While the Matlab AI code generator is a powerful tool, it's not without limitations. Some potential challenges include:
?? Steep learning curve for new users unfamiliar with Simulink or embedded systems
?? Licensing costs can be high for small teams or startups
?? Limited AI customization for niche applications
Final Thoughts: Is Matlab AI Code Generation the Future?
The answer is a resounding yes. With continuous improvements in AI model training, automation tools, and hardware compatibility, the Matlab AI code generator is set to become a standard part of every engineering toolkit. For professionals aiming to stay competitive in industries like automotive, robotics, aerospace, or healthcare, now is the time to master AI-based code generation.
Whether you're just starting with Simulink models or deploying machine learning code to embedded systems, the best AI for Matlab code will ensure your designs are faster, more accurate, and easier to scale than ever before.
Key Takeaways
? Matlab AI code generation simplifies algorithm deployment
? Boosts productivity across industries like automotive and aerospace
? Tools like MATLAB Coder and Embedded Coder lead the way
? AI Matlab code generator improves consistency and reduces errors
Learn more about AI CODE